PIC vs ATMEL #2 volt most: LOVE C

Füzesi Arnold arno at freemail.hu
Thu Feb 12 13:59:08 CET 2004


Hjajjj.
En arrol beszelek, hogy ahhoz kepest, hogy a C magas szintu nyelv igen
hatekony.
Olyan procira, amit C-re IS "optimalizaltak", meg termeszetesen ASM-re IS
nincs gyakorlatilag kulonbseg
az ASM meg a C kozott.

Nekem nagyon ritkan van gondom a C forditoval, hogy hibas kodot general.
Nem tudom, Ti honnan szeditek ezt a hulyeseget, hogy a forditok bugosak mint
az allat, meg felni kell toluk.
Ez olyan dolog, hogy meg kell tanulni a C alap dolgait. Es akkor nincs gond.
De MEG KELL tanulni!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!

Egyik haverom olyan cegnel dolgozik, ahol a Volvo-nak stb. irnak sw-t.
Termeszetesen C-ben, mert tobbek kozott az ASM ezen a szinten mar
megbizhatatlan!!!!!!!!
(Atlathatatlan, nincs fikarcnyi szemantikai ellenorzes sem benne csak
szintaktikai.)
Nem erzitek azt, hogy az ASM meg a C kozott alig van kulonbseg, cserebe
viszont
sokkal magasabb szinten lehet programozni.Az meg hogy a C bugos, meg bla az
hulyeseg.
Jo forditot kell hasznalni, es kesz.Annyira bugos az ember is mint a jo
fordito...
A dokumentaciot meg egyszer el kell olvasni RENDESEN.
A nap 12 orajaban programozok, vagy nyakot tervezek.
Nem igen szoktam leakadni a programozassal. Vagy ha igen, és nem jovok ra
1-2ora alatt, akkor megirom a listara, kozben csinalom
a tobbi reszet a proginak. Megjon a valasz, hogy termeszetesen megint en
voltam a hulye, kijavitom, és
megtanulom egy eletre. Milyen surun is szoktam panikolni, hogy bajom van a
forditoval?
Felevente egyszer. Akkor is mert hajnal volt, es az elso doksit olvastam el,
amit a google kinyomott.

Ez olyan mintha azon vitatkoznank, hogy egy ferrari-val azert nem jo
autozni, mert kicsit tobbet fogyaszt mint a tobbi sportkocsi. :)))
Agyrem...

Ja, az urbe kilott cuccok is C-ben vannak irva. (VmWare oprendszere megy
rajta...)
Ha asm-ben irnak meg most csinalnak az elso pioneer szondat, es ugyan ugy
lezuhanna az is, mert benne van az emberi tenyezo....

Arnold
----- Original Message ----- 
From: "Csobolyó János" <janchika at uze.net>
To: <elektro at tesla.hu>
Sent: Thursday, February 12, 2004 7:39 AM
Subject: Re: PIC vs ATMEL #2 volt most: LOVE C


VF  <vf at elte.hu> 2004.02.12. 02:13:26 +2h-kor írta:

> Thus spake Füzesi Arnold <arno at freemail.hu>:
>
> > Sebesseggel meg nincs gond tul nagy, mert egyszer inicializal, aztan
kesz.
> > Noveli csokkenti a pointert, mikozben ir-olvas.
> > Asszem mar az atmega-ban is van ilyen.
>
> Sot, az m68k-ban is volt... CISC proci, szo sincs C-re optimalizalasrol.

eddig mindig azt mondtatok hogy a C milyen jol optimalizal
most meg kiderul hogy a procit kenne ala optimalizalni

mivolna ha ugy kozelitenetek meg a kerdest
hogy a fordito olyan amilyen
a proci szinten
es ERRE a kornyezetre kell hatekony kodot irni
azt meg lehet minden nyelven

nem a forditotol lesz egy program jo
igen is kell folyamat abra szerusegeket skiccelni es nagyon atkell gondolni
nyelvtol fuggetlenul.
hiaban optimalizal jol a fordito es hiaba hatekony a proci ha egyszer szarul
van megirva es atgondolatlan a program

a programozas mar csak olyan hogy meg kell elote tervezni mit is akarsz
csinalni.
ez nem hagyhato ki semilyen nyelvnel.


eleg kenyelmes dolog a forditora hivatkozni vagy elbujni a hata moge
hogy a program ugyis jo mert bekapcsoltam a megaturbohiperfasza
optimalizalast



-- 







More information about the Elektro mailing list